Played Barb Shaman on live and ended up trashing my druid faction killing in Plane of Growth in Velious. If you plan on raiding in Velious in PoG going to ruin it anyways. As a Shaman you never have to interact with the Druid/Ranger factions other than at a couple of druid rings that have Treants. You should invis when porting to NK/WK rings, some will say also invis for WC ones but I never do and have never been attacked as load in spot is out of agro range.
Plus what Shaman isn't invis when traveling anyways! I say Kill the Treants and profit.

I suppose I do plan on raiding in PoG eventually, but are you sure about the factions here?
From what I can read:
A Treant:
Guards of Qeynos (-30)
Jaggedpine Treefolk (-30)
Protectors of Pine (-30)
QRG Protected Animals (-30)
Mobs in PoG:
Clerics of Tunare (-30)
Faydarks Champions (-30)
Servants of Tunare (-30)
Soldiers of Tunare (-30)
